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ia - Cite This SourceDassault Group, (GIMD, Groupe Dassault, or the Groupe Industriel Marcel Dassault S.A.) is a French group of companies led by Serge Dassault.
Managing directors are Claude Dassault and Olivier Costa De Beauregard.
Subsidiaries
- Dassault Aviation;
- Dassault Falcon Jet;
- S.A.B.C.A. (design and manufacturing of aerospace equipment);
- Sogitec (simulation and integrated logistic support systems);
- Dassault Systèmes (PLM development solutions);
- Société de Véhicules Electriques (SVE), a joint venture between Dassault and Heuliez for the development of electric and plug-in electric hybrid vehicles (Cleanova II based on Renault Kangoo), its President and CEO is Gérard Thery;
- Figaro (media, including Le Figaro and FC Nantes Atlantique);
- Immobiliere Dassault (real estate);
- Artcurial (auctions).
